Excellence an after-school maths and science program. We replace/supplement private tutoring and long-term study programs such as Kumon (over 30B TAM). US Parents are our primary customers. Our web and iPad software serves both ambitious and struggling students. As we believe each student is unique, we adapt our high quality courses and exercises to their knowledge and learning style in a very granular way. To facilitate learning, they get detailed text, voice and graphical explanations, can craft study plans, revise and memorize, and received human mentorship if needed. We believe LLMs have made edtech interesting, as technology now allows us to replicate a tutoring learning experience. In addition, we offer a program with daily courses and exercises, detailed feedback on their worksheets and more (super Kumon). Finally we sell the AI tutoring and exercise databases to schools in a B2B and B2B2C model and already work for the most prestigious institutions in France (Ecole polytechnique, college Stanislas...). We're a passionate team of ex-quants, mathematicians and physics champions devoted to improving science education.
